It’s a straightforward build. You just need a dowel rod, two long carriage bolts (4 inches for this version), plus some washers and wing nuts. The whole thing costs a bit over $8. It could have been less expensive, but I chose the oak rod since it’s sturdier and looks better than the alternative at Home Depot—I’m guessing that one is something like pine. Image Cut the dowel into two equal sections, each matching your hip width. Mine came out to 17 inches. Drill the holes, slide in the bolts, and secure them with nuts. One thing I don’t love about the commercial The Humbler is its curve. That curve lets you stand up fully upright, even if it’s not super comfortable. This DIY version has no curve at all, making standing up nearly impossible for me (though your mileage may vary depending on your body type). It feels much more humbling than the branded one.
